Как переместить файл на рабочем столе в каталоге?

Я хочу переместить .php файл с именем My Form.php который я сохранил на рабочем столе, прежде чем \var\www,

Когда я использую: sudo mv My Form.php www в терминале пишет что такого файла нет My.php а также Form.php,

2 ответа

Решение

Вам нужно поместить имя файла внутри "" двойные кавычки, потому что у вашего файла есть пробел в его имени, и поэтому он рассматривается как отдельный файл от оболочки. Вам нужно либо оформить sudo mv "My Form.php" /var/www или же sudo mv My\ Form.php /var/www обратная косая черта \ перед пробелом является escape-персонаж. Обратите внимание, что в Ubuntu (и в целом под Linux) путь к файлу описывается с помощью / и не \

Откройте терминал и запустите этот комманд:

sudo mv ~/Desktop/My\ Form.php /var/www

Вот что вы сделали не так:

Я использую: sudo mv My Form.php www в терминале

  • sudo mv My Form.php

    mv интерпретирует есть два файла: My а также Form.phpследовательно, обратный слеш перед пробелом. Также можно использовать двойные кавычки (sudo mv "~/Desktop/My Form.php" /var/www).

  • www

    Это тебе совсем не поможет; ваша цель /var/www

Другие вопросы по тегам